Crownline E235 vs Princecraft Vogue 27 XT Tri — Depreciation Comparison

Crownline E235 vs Princecraft Vogue 27 XT Tri: 5-year value retention (60% vs 61%), resale value, and cost of ownership head-to-head. Princecraft Vogue 27 XT Tri holds its value better.

On five-year value retention the Princecraft Vogue 27 XT Tri comes out ahead, holding about 61% of its value versus 60% for the Crownline E235. Over the first five years the Princecraft Vogue 27 XT Tri loses roughly $35,169 while the Crownline E235 loses about $49,090 — a gap near $13,921.

First-year drop is the biggest factor: the Princecraft Vogue 27 XT Tri sheds about 8% in year one versus 30% for the Crownline E235. If you buy used, the steeper early drop is what the original owner absorbs.
